Company Description

Mersal Foundation is a health charity founded in 2015, serving Egyptian and non-Egyptian patients in need without discrimination, while adhering to a strict code of ethics and safeguarding patient privacy. The organization operates five branches in Cairo and Alexandria and partnerships with a network of medical professionals and facilities. Mersal offers direct health care, including oncology, physiotherapy, psychiatry, and speech clinics, and conducts campaigns to address specific health issues, such as cochlear implants for children. It is also completing its patient accommodation facility in Cairo for individuals receiving treatment without housing options. With a record of significant growth and trust in donations, Mersal is driven by a national and regional expansion vision.

Job Description

  • Implement Quality Standards
  • Ensure adherence to national and international quality standards (e.g., JCI, GAHAR, ISO) across all departments.
  • Monitor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)
  • Track and analyse quality indicators related to patient safety, clinical outcomes, and service efficiency.
  • Conduct Internal Audits
  • Perform regular audits and inspections to identify areas for improvement and ensure compliance with policies and procedures.
  • Support Accreditation Processes
  • Prepare documentation and coordinate activities related to healthcare accreditation and licensing.
  • Incident Reporting and Analysis
  • Participate in the investigation of clinical and non-clinical incidents, and follow up on corrective and preventive actions.
  • Quality Improvement Projects
  • Lead and support quality improvement initiatives in collaboration with various departments.
  • Train and Educate Staff
  • Deliver training sessions and workshops on quality standards, patient safety, risk management, and reporting tools.
  • Prepare Reports and Presentations
  • Compile quality-related data and present findings to hospital leadership and relevant committees.
  • Develop Policies and Procedures
  • Assist in the development, review, and update of hospital policies, protocols, and standard operating procedures.
  • Enhance Patient Safety Culture
  • Promote a culture of continuous improvement, safety, and patient-centered care across the organization.

Job Requirements

  • Must hold a Bachelor's degree in Pharmacy, Medicine, or Dentistry.
  • Minimum of 1 year of experience in a hospital or healthcare quality-related role.
  • Must hold a recognized qualification in quality, such as:
  • Hospital Quality Diploma
  • Total Quality Management (TQM)
  • Certified Professional in Healthcare Quality (CPHQ)

  • Strong understanding of healthcare standards and accreditation requirements (e.g., JCI, GAHAR).

  • Excellent analytical and reporting skills.
  • Ability to conduct audits, analyze KPIs, and implement improvement plans.
  • Effective communication and coordination across clinical and non-clinical teams.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and quality management tools.
